About The Position

The Forensic Evaluator conducts comprehensive assessments and evaluations of individuals involved in the criminal justice system to determine mental health, behavioral, and rehabilitative needs. This role provides objective, evidence-based evaluations to support legal decisions, treatment planning, and risk management. The Forensic Evaluator collaborates with clinical teams, correctional staff, and legal authorities to ensure evaluations are accurate, timely, and compliant with organizational and regulatory standards.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ct psychological, behavioral, and forensic assessments of individuals in correctional or forensic settings.
  • Interview patients to gather relevant social, medical, psychological, and behavioral history.
  • Evaluate risk factors, mental health status, and rehabilitation needs to inform legal and clinical decisions.
  • Prepare detailed, objective, and professional evaluation reports for legal authorities, parole boards, or clinical teams.
  • Collaborate with correctional staff, mental health professionals, and interdisciplinary teams to collect necessary information for evaluations.
  • Participate in case conferences, parole hearings, and interdisciplinary treatment meetings as required.
  • Provide recommendations for treatment, supervision, and risk management based on evaluation findings.
  • Maintain accurate, confidential, and timely documentation in the Electronic Health Record (EHR) or designated reporting systems.
  • Ensure compliance with HIPAA, PREA, and federal, state, and local regulations.
